I was faced with a similar issue recently and ended up getting a MAGIC NS 2 adapter which lets the DualShock 4 (among other things) work perfectly with the PS3. I've been playing through the Metal Gear Solid collection using a DS4 and it has worked fine (rumble and PS button work fine).

Quoting again for possible troubleshooting help.

I just got mine and connected the PS4 controller wirelessly to the PS3 with it, but the PS button doesn't work. It's like it's connected to the PS3 as a generic Bluetooth controller.

The video guide I followed said to just plug in the adapter, switch the mode to PS3 (after turning the console on) then pair the PS4 controller to it.

Did you do something different to get it to work perfectly?

Finished Deliver Us the Moon the other night and I was really impressed. Great mix of chill look-around areas and environmental hazard/low oxygen races against the clock. Sometimes it's 3rd person perspective, other times 1st. I thought the story was pretty interesting, it's totally not a horror game. If you're looking for a "explore a research base gone dark" game and don't like horror, this is for you. It's part of ps+ extra as well. A sequel is coming out in a few months, Deliver Us Mars, looks like you get a new traversal tool. I usually just beat a game and move on but this one really grabbed me. Once I upgraded my ps+ and got access to a bunch of games, I've been playing like 20 minutes, going hmmm, and trying something else. But this one was a keeper. Definitely going to buy the sequel, want to support the devs for making something different.
